HISTORY
  • First used in 1800s as SACK TRUCKS.
  • Powered truck came into being in the early 20th
    century.
  • These trucks became popular due to the shortage
    of labour in WW-I.
  • Clark first gave the counter balanced truck in
    1917, Yale produced the first electric truck in
    1925.
  • Post WW-II, Warehouses needed more maneuverable
    forklift trucks with higher demands.
  • Soon many types of trucks came into existence to
    meet these demands.

FORKLIFT PRINCIPLES
THE LEVER
  • Lever It is one of the simplest mechanical
    devices. However, a lever by itself is not
    effective. It must have something on to pivot.
    This pivot is called a fulcrum.
  • Law of Equilibrium The effort multiplied by its
    distance from the fulcrum equals the load
    multiplied by its distance from the fulcrum. This
    law of equilibrium is true for all classes of
    levers.

CENTRE OF GRAVITY
  • It is the point on an object at which all of the
    objects weight is concentrated. For symmetrical
    loads, the center of gravity is at the middle of
    the load.

18
FORKLIFT STABILITY
  • A forklift trucks ability to stay upright while
    it is in motion is its stability.
  • It is the most important aspect to avoid
    accidents.
  • The lateral stability of a truck changes
    depending on how high the load is lifted to.
  • The rated lift capacity is reduced at increased
    lifting height.

19
STABILITY TRIANGLE
  • Almost all counterbalanced powered industrial
    trucks have a three-point suspension system.
  • The triangle formed between points A, B, and C is
    called the Stability Triangle.
  • The truck will not tip over as long as the center
    of gravity(C.G.) remains inside the triangle.
